As the Diamond Fire continues to burn in north Scottsdale, here are the latest updates.

Beginning at around 5:15 pm on Tuesday, June 27, near 130th and Ranch Gate Road, the brush fire quickly sprawled into an estimated 2,500-acre wildfire.

At a news briefing Wednesday morning, Tiffany Davila, spokesperson for the Arizona Department of Forestry and Fire Management said the fire remained at 0% containment, and winds were expected to pick up later Wednesday.

LOOK: Chiefs unveil stunning Super Bowl rings to celebrate second NFL title in four years

chiefsring. jpg
Photo courtesy Kansas City Chiefs

If there’s a diamond shortage around the world in the next few days, you can probably go ahead and blame the Kansas City Chiefs.

After four months of waiting, the Chiefs finally got their Super Bowl rings on Thursday night and when you look at the new ring, the first thing you’ll notice is that it has a lot of diamonds. The exact number is 629: There are 609 round diamonds, 16 baguette diamonds and four marquise diamonds.

How Russia-Ukraine war served as a wake-up call for Surat’s diamond industry

Last week, around 350 of the thousands of workers at Laxmi Diamonds, a cutting and polishing factory in Surat’s Varachha, called a protest demanding a salary hike and pay vacation.

Owned by the Gajera brothers, the factory had declared a summer vacation from May 5 to May 28. But the workers were called back, and the factory resumed functioning on May 22. Hundreds, however, took to the streets on Thursday as they sought pay for the vacation period and a hike.

How a Humble Piece of Rock Solved a Long-Standing Diamond Mystery

ShinyDiamond

Two QUT researchers used a standard laptop and a piece of rock from a diamond mine waste pile to solve a long-standing geological puzzle about diamond formation in the Earth’s ancient continents.

Two researchers from Queensland University of Technology (QUT) have utilized a simple laptop computer and a piece of rock, obtained from a diamond mine’s “waste pile”, to unravel a long-standing geological mystery surrounding the formation of diamonds in the deep roots of the earth’s ancient continents.
